G.I. Joe Flint Russian Release AFA 80 (Funskool, 1992). Flint has always been the guy you send when the situation needs a leader who can think and act at the same time, a warrant officer who doesn't wait for orders when the plan falls apart. This Russian-market release from Funskool carries his 1985 design into the brand's long international afterlife, using the original mold while introducing the production quirks that define these later runs. Examples tied to Funskool production show noticeable differences in color, with lighter tones on the uniform and web gear, along with variations in construction across different runs as available parts were used. These figures remained in circulation for years in the Indian market, with multiple releases extending into the early 2000s, giving the mold an unusually long and evolving production history compared to its U.S. counterpart. Graded AFA 80 NM with subgrades of C80 B80 F85, this example is one of only five graded on the population report. Auction Type
Signature Session - Extended Bidding: These auctions are presented via catalog and online and bidding is only taken through our website. There are two phases of bidding during this type of auction: 1) Normal bidding: Bids are taken up until 7:00 PM CT the night the auction closes. 2) 15 Minute Ending: On a lot-by-lot basis, starting at 7:00 PM CT, any person who has bid on the lot previously may continue to bid on that lot until there are no more bids for 15 minutes. For example, if you bid on a lot during Normal Bidding, you could participate during Extended Bidding for that lot, but not on lots you did not bid on previously. If a bid was placed at 7:03, the new end time for that lot would become 7:18. If no other bids were placed before 7:18, the lot would close. If you are the high bidder on a lot, changing your bid will not extend the bidding during the 15 Minute Ending phase (only a bid from another bidder will extend bidding). If you are the only bidder at 7 PM, you will automatically win the lot at 7:15. Important: After normal bidding ends, you must be signed-on to the Heritage site to see the bidding option on lots where you qualify for extended bidding and you must be on an individual lot page to reflect the accurate time remaining for that particular lot.
